[00:01.75]It's the beginning of winter, high up on the Tibetan plateau [00:10.44]The temperature will soon drop to minus 40 Celsius [00:29.7]Out here,life is reduced to a single imperative - survival [00:44.95]For the argali, the world's largest sheep [00:49.21]it means searching for a few tufts of grass [01:08.38]Descending from the hilltops to lower altitudes the argali band together for safety [01:17.66]Hopefully, down here,they'll be able to find enough food to last them through the rest of the winter [01:37.43]Although this winter landscape looks barren and forbidding [01:41.98]Tibet's remote grasslands support a surprising variety of creatures [01:47.67]Though at this time of year, they can be hard to track down
